Step 1
In a large pot of salted, boiling water, cook the rotini to al dente, according to the package directions. Drain the water.
Step 2
In a large bowl, add the olive oil, the lemon zest, the lemon juice, the salt, and the black pepper and whisk to combine.
Step 3
Add the cooked rotini to the dressing mixture and toss to coat.
Step 4
Place the rotini mixture in the refrigerator to cool, about 1 hour.
Step 5
Add the spinach, the basil, the parsley, the dill, the chives, the tarragon, and 1/2 of the parmesan cheese to the rotini mixture and toss to combine.
Step 6
Serve the pasta salad garnished with the remaining parmesan cheese.
